Quentin Tarantino's 2007 movie Grindhouse consisted of two feature length segments (Planet Terror and Death Proof) and was bookended by fictional trailers, advertisements, and theater announcements. As the term Grindhouse refers to movie theaters that show mostly B films, the fake trailers where meant to reflect that kind of quality. Hobo with a Shotgun was one of those phony trailers, and based on that trailer they made a feature length film. This is also how the movie Machete came to be.
